NTest Opens European Support Center in Denmark
Minneapolis, MN (PRWEB) March 25, 2015 -- As part of its ongoing commitment to provide an outstanding customer experience, NTest Inc. today celebrated the opening of a new state-of-the-art FiberWatch™ support center in Copenhagen, Denmark. The FiberWatch™ fiber monitoring product line quickly locates fiber optic failures in telecommunications service providers, cable operators, utility, and power companies in over 50 countries throughout the globe.
Today's announcement underscores NTest's continued investments in Europe. The company has strong growth in the EMEA region and continues to see opportunities there.
We are thrilled to be officially opening this new support center in Copenhagen,'' said Jorge Cano, Vice President of Engineering and co-founder of NTest. "We can support our customers better in their own time zone and enhance the top tier support that our clients need to run their business effectively"
NTest will be partnering with 2Test, which has already been supporting the FiberWatch™ RFTS product line for over 10 years with tier one providers like Telia in Sweden.
"The 2Test team is equipped with the latest tools and technologies designed to help improve our customers' experiences with us, and we're looking forward to its continued growth and future successes,'' said Kim Skjoldman, CEO of 2Test. "This is an ideal location with a strong and talented labor market and we're grateful to continue our growth jointly with NTest.''
The NTest executive team is attending the Optical Fiber Conference (OFC 2015) in Los Angeles to launch this initiative with many of the European customers visiting the conference.
About NTest
NTest is a leading provider of optical communications test and measurement solutions for telecommunications service providers and cable operators in more than 45 countries. The FiberWatch™ product line utilizes an industry leading 4th generation fiber monitoring engine which includes optical fiber mapping software that enables customers to assess the state of the network. In the event of a cable issue, the monitoring system is able to detect the physical problem, diagnose the problem, and then correlate this information with the Geographical Information System (GIS) documentation system to isolate the fault and notify network operators.
